Image:11D58Mengine.jpg 400px The close-cycle liquid fuel rocket engine 11D58M of TsKBEM development. This engine of 8.5 tons thrust uses oxygen and hydrocarbon fuel as propellant components. It was the world’s first engine to provide multiple in-flight firing. Category:Engine
